Soundcam Octagon All-in-one Soundcam for Demanding Measurements The Octagon system is the perfect solution for all challenging measurements. 192 microphones in an acoustic transparent frame guarantee high precision with the highest dynamic. Due to the dense microphone distribution, beamforming as well as holography measurements are possible – covering a frequency range from 30 – 24.000 Hz. The integrated data acquisition makes it a handy system with no set-up time. 4 digital and 4 analog channels can be directly connected to the Octagon for your additional sensors. The array comes with an integrated Intel® RealSense™ depth camera which features Full HD resolution and the ability to record 3D data. BENEFITS All-in-one Acoustic Camera Extremely high acoustic dynamic Excellent holography results due to high microphone density Interface for 4 digital and 4 analog channels Acoustically transparent The fiber-carbon construction makes the octagon stable and light at the same time, integrated handles allow for an easy transport or handheld measurements. All these features make the Octagon the perfect system for a wide range of applications in R&D, quality assurance, maintenance or environmental acoustics. Detailed acoustic analysis of products and components Detection of masked sources Leakage detection for buildings and pipes Correlation measurements order analysis of rotating parts The Octagon can be placed on the ground or on a tripod
